Members on Fanfiction.net said I am too harsh and cruel when giving my reviews.

Remember when I said I had a friend wanting to build a fan fiction website and wanted me to do reviews? Well, he put me through a test on Fanfiction.net.

This is the story I wrote a review for. Hannibal: The Golden Pen.

This is my review.
Quote:
The writing was a little blah.

''She walked to the source of the voice and then found her boss staring up at her.''

Is her boss a midget or is Clarice the new jolly green giant?

There was a few other sentences in your story that are just like the example I gave you.

Also, Hannibal talks in riddles and you've failed to capture that. I can see you tried to make him sound intelligent or witty by using old cliché phrases like ''curiosity killed the cat''. Even though a fan of the books would know that Hannibal wouldn't say such a thing. He also wouldn't come straight out and tell Clarice he had a problem. He would lure her to him and manipulate her into solving it or drop clues to get her to figure it out for herself.

Clarice is also extremely out of character. She's a strong impendent woman. You made her look anything but.

Sorry if this isn't the kind of review you were hoping for. Just keep this in mind. Everyone has to start from the beginning. You learn through experiences. You will get better if you try hard. Put your mind into and don’t rush. Even this story can become a master piece. Just go over it and put some feeling into.
People messaged me saying I was too hard on this member, even though I tried to encourage him/her in the end.

Quite frankly, I'm starting to regret this.
